The factory-spec stuff works very well, unless you have an underlying, hidden problem.
"Heavy Duty" radiator is not needed and may actually impair heat transfer if it is too thick.
Based on what we see on this Forum when your circumstance crops up, it usually ends up being a problem in the head. Any and all non-TUPY 0331 is suspect, even though it may be "new" and/or "rebuilt". Those things are just poison and are good for nothing except a money-draining heartache.
